The USN operates a fleet of nuclear-powered *Nimitz*-class and *Ford*-class carriers, which are significantly larger and more capable than China's current carriers. They are based on nuclear power, have electromagnetic catapults, and are able to carry more aircraft. The US Navy's carriers have a long history of global deployments and combat operations, making them a very experienced and formidable force. They have a huge advantage when it comes to technology and experience. In comparison, China's carriers are still developing and refining their operational capabilities. However, China is rapidly closing the gap. The *Fujian*, with its EMALS, is a significant step toward narrowing the technological gap. Russia's sole aircraft carrier, the *Admiral Kuznetsov*, is in a state of disrepair. This means that China's carriers are already more advanced, and China's carrier program is more advanced than Russia's. The UK, France, and India also have their own aircraft carrier programs, but their fleets are smaller and less capable than those of the US and China. The UK's *Queen Elizabeth*-class carriers are advanced but rely on a limited number of F-35B fighter jets. The French Navy's *Charles de Gaulle* is a nuclear-powered carrier, but is smaller than the US carriers and carries fewer aircraft. India operates a mix of carriers, including the *Vikramaditya* (a modified Soviet-era carrier) and the *Vikrant*, but its carrier program is still in the developmental phase. Other countries, like Japan and South Korea, are exploring the possibility of acquiring or developing aircraft carriers, but their programs are still in the early stages. The overall comparison is complex, but here's a general summary. The US is still in the lead because of its size and experience. China is rapidly catching up, while other nations have smaller, less capable carrier programs.
